Overview

Description

To tap into the cultural conversations surrounding semi-autonomous driving and the widespread anger over passing-lane drivers, we launched “Lane Valet,” an innovative technology that allows Lexus drivers to do lane hogs the courtesy of moving their vehicles for them with the press of a button. Then, to catch people when and where they’d least expect it, we broadcast the April Fools’ spot on TV–a first for any brand.

Execution

Because April 1 fell on a Saturday, we began a phased rollout early to maximize reach. On March 29, :15 teaser videos were released on Lexus social channels. The next day, Lexus issued an official press release and a :45 version of the spot launched on social channels. Additionally, paid search went into effect and a highly polished product page was launched on lexus.com that went into further detail about Lane Valet, with a prompt at the bottom of the page to learn about other (real) Lexus safety innovations. On March 31, an e-mail was sent to 10,000 LC handraisers. Finally, on April 1, to amplify the message and further cut through a bevy of online April Fools’ campaigns, Lexus broadcast the spot a dozen times on Comedy Central, SNL and during the Men’s Final Four basketball tournament–where it was viewed by more than 25 million unsuspecting people.

Outcome

The final numbers proved it to be an overwhelming success for Lexus: 485MM+ PR impressions, 181 articles written and 30K visits to lexus.com. On the Lexus social channels, the video spread worldwide: Of the 72MM impressions, there were 10.5MM video views. And of those viewers, almost half (4.5MM) went on to like, share or comment. Not surprisingly, it’s now the most shared Facebook post in Lexus history. A few results that were surprising: It was referenced by a state senator to help pass legislation, Elon Musk was asked about it, and three media outlets, including a top online automotive site in the U.S., were so fooled by the execution that they requested more details.
